    Greetings from Belgium, Europe

    Hi everyone,

    my name is Sam. I love backpacking and bushcraft and are relatively new to hammocking (tried it out in october and been loving it ever since) but now it's my primary sleeping system in the woods.

    I'm also a photographer (mostly abandoned places and urban exploring) and bring my heavy dslr camera and a ukelele along with me.

    I was looking up some ways to hang a hammock and found Shugs youtube channel (wich directed me here, thanks for that).

    My current hammock is a DD travel with the DD tarp but I also have a DIY hammock with integrated tarp and bug netting (pretty comfortable but I made it a bit too small and because the tarp is integrated there is nowhere to hang my equipment to stay dry).

    My favorite knife is a mora companion (it's super cheap and pretty sturdy).

    i'm 1.85m (6.06955381 feet (6 feet 53⁄64 inch)) and weigh 92kg (202.825281 pounds)
